Handover for review: ValvKit, our plugin system for data validators. All plugin registration now goes through the manifest loader; legacy hooks are removed. One operational note for the reviewer: the signing vault for plugin manifests can only be reopened with the recovery passphrase if the session expires. That passphrase is recorded below.

strongbox words: norwyn-wenael-aldvan-aldiel-wendor-holael

Subject: Transcoding farm ownership change

Hello — as you review the upcoming Pellwick changes, please note that responsibility for the Fernhollow transcoding farm has shifted teams. The GPU worker pool, the preset catalogue, and the retry queue all now fall under the Media Runtime group. Review requests touching encoder configs or farm autoscaling should be routed accordingly, and any change with capacity implications needs an extra approval. Effective this sprint, all sign-offs on farm-related merges go to the person named below.

account owner for bawip-tahag: Raleth Quenok

## Account Recovery — Quota Service

Per-tenant rate quotas on Lattervale are enforced by the QuotaGate sidecar. If a tenant admin is locked out after quota exhaustion, reset counters via the ops shell, then re-issue the tenant token. Do not raise global limits during a release window. Token re-issue prompts for the vault recovery passphrase before it writes anything. For release-manager use only, the passphrase follows on the next line.

recovery phrase for fawif-tajeg: norael-aldmir-casir-brivan-ulaion